The Federal Reserve Board employs over 300 Ph.D. economists, who represent an exceptionally diverse range of interests and specific areas of expertise. Board economists conduct cutting edge research, produce numerous working papers, and are among the leading contributors at professional meetings and in major journals. Our economists also produce a wide variety of economic analyses and forecasts for the Board of Governors and the Federal Open Market Committee.

Division of Board Members

Division of Board Members supports the Board of Governors and its responsibilities; facilitates effective communication between the Board and Congress; provides the public with information concerning Federal Reserve actions and decisions and increases the public's understanding of the System's functions, responsibilities, and policy goals.
